KITCHEN ANNOUNCES FUNDING FOR WASTE
MANAGEMENT IMPROVEMENTS
|

Kitchen |
PHILADELPHIA, August 3 –
Philadelphia will soon receive state funding
to improve waste management in the city,
according to state Sen. Shirley Kitchen.
The $120,000 grant will be used to reimburse
up to 80 percent of the costs to revise the
city’s solid waste management plan.
“I am pleased that the city and state are
working together to keep Philadelphia up to
date with its waste management,” Kitchen
said. “Together, the city and state can help
Philadelphia function properly for our
citizens.”
The funding was administered by the
Department of Environmental Protection’s
County Planning Grant Program.
